Sports Car GT was published by Electronic Arts (EA) and developed by Image Space Incorporated for Microsoft Windows, and Point of View for PlayStation. Both editions of the game feature co-development by Westwood Studios. In season mode (championship), the player has to race in four GT classes. Each of these classes have five race tracks (GT1 has four). The player starts in the GT qualifying class (GTQ), taking part in 4 races of 3 laps each: Sebring Int'l Short, Road Atlanta, Mosport Park and Desert Speedway. Once this championship has been complete you are given an invitational 1v1 challenge at Sebring Int'l Short to attempt to win a race version of the BMW M3. GT3 class consists of 5 races of 3 laps each, held at Road Atlanta (Wet), Mosport Park, Sebring Int'l Short (Wet), Desert Speedway and Laguna Seca Raceway. No special invitationals are rewarded for winning this championship. GT2 consists of 5 races of 4 laps each at Sebring Int'l Raceway, Desert Speedway, Mosport Park (Wet), Sebring Int'l Short and Laguna Seca Raceway Reverse. For winning this championship you are given another 3-lap 1v1 invitational at Mosport Park (Wet) for a chance to win a Callaway C7R GT1 car. GT1 class is the longest of them all. It features 5 races of varying lap distances. Starting at Sebring Int'l Raceway (Wet) for 5 laps, Road Atlanta for 5 laps, Desert Speedway for 7 laps, Mosport Park for 10 laps, Road Atlanta Reverse for 15 laps and finally Sebring Int'l Raceway for a mammoth 20 laps. Once this championship is completed you unlock a bonus championship; The Paris GT1. The Paris GT1 is rather anti-climactic. It features three races on two new courses of only 3 laps each. Course de Triumph and two races at Eiffel Tour, one in dry and one in wet conditions. Once this championship is complete the credits roll and the game is finished. All cars can be upgraded (excluding special models that you win via the 1 v 1 challenge). The player can modify the car to increase its performance and value. Once a component has been upgraded, it can be installed or removed at any time. Components that can be upgraded are: brakes, suspension, exhaust, engine, gearbox, aero kit and the tires of the car. The player can tune their car. Not tuning in making a design to the car or spray with colour, but change the optimum performance of the car.
